Chapter 230: Chapter 230: Survivors of Ohara

About half an hour later.

Adrian was in Tommy's office when he met "Doctor Moy" again, someone he had encountered once before in the Drum Kingdom.

This doctor was the same person who, after mistakenly eating the Paramecia-type Bandage Fruit, was misunderstood as a terrifying monster by ignorant townsfolk, and consequently targeted for elimination by the Drum Kingdom's authorities.

It had been a long time since they last met, but Doctor Moy was still dressed the same way as when they parted at the Drum Island dock.

Clad in a black long-sleeve shirt, black pants, black leather boots, and a black cloak, almost his entire body was black. Only his face and hands, wrapped tightly in white bandages, were exposed, with just his eyes visible.

Seeing Adrian, Doctor Moy seemed a bit emotional, greeting him in a hoarse and dry voice.

"Y-your Ex-excellency, it's b-been a l-long time."

Adrian glanced at Doctor Moy calmly.

"Long time no see."

It seemed the social anxiety trauma that Doctor Moy developed previously had not improved at all. In fact, it appeared to have worsened, as he had not stuttered this badly before.

Doctor Moy attempted to say something more, "Y-you Ex-excel..."

Adrian, feeling a headache coming on, had to interrupt him with a raised hand.

"Doctor Moy, I'll speak, you listen. Is that alright?"

At that moment, several slender white bandages suddenly emerged from Doctor Moy's body, quickly forming the words "No problem" in the air.

Adrian blinked in surprise.

A live intelligence, fully automated subtitle display?

Putting aside his astonishment, Adrian slowly said, "It seems Doctor Moy has been training his Bandage Fruit abilities well during this period. Your skills seem to have improved a lot."

Doctor Moy displayed, "Yes. When I first arrived in the West Blue, the Razor Gang had a lot of injured members almost daily. While treating their injuries, my abilities unknowingly improved a lot. Of course, the situation improved significantly after those immortal drifters joined the Razor Gang en masse because they seem not to get injured at all. Their body structure is very peculiar; I originally wanted to dissect one..."

Adrian quickly raised his hand to stop him.

He never expected that after changing his way of communication, Doctor Moy would transform into a cold, emotionless typing machine, producing such a long string of words in the blink of an eye.

What was this?

An extroverted social anxiety sufferer?

The telepathic typing ability was quite enviable, and the accuracy was impressively high.

"Doctor Moy, I asked Tommy to invite you here because I need your help with something."

Abandoning the idea of small talk, Adrian got straight to business.

"I have a group of civilians who have fallen into a long sleep. I need you to check their physical condition."

For players with panels and fully data-driven bodies, falling into a prolonged sleep after being hit by the Dream ghost would only result in losing stamina and health points. They could just respawn if they died.

But for ordinary Ohara residents, who were real flesh and blood, prolonged sleep without food or drink could seriously affect their health.

This was why Adrian had Tommy invite Doctor Moy. The doctor, whom Adrian had personally rescued from the Drum Kingdom, was much more trustworthy than any unfamiliar doctor.

Doctor Moy displayed, "I never thought I could help you, this is wonderful!"

Adrian had Rumi use her abilities to transport Doctor Moy into the stronghold, while Adrian himself followed.

The Ohara residents were placed in a specially isolated area within the castle space, a privilege of the Castle fruit user.

Looking at the deeply sleeping Ohara residents in the room, Doctor Moy asked, "These are the people who need to be examined?"

"Yes, Doctor Moy, I'll leave this to you. I have some other matters to do."

Adrian nodded, silently leaving a transparent ghost in the room, then departed the space housing the Ohara residents and went to another room designated for the scholars.

After some thought, Adrian used his abilities to awaken Dr. Clover, Mrs. Penelope, and the Nico mother and daughter.

"Adrian," Dr. Clover frowned, massaging his temples as he recalled, "Is this your special castle space?"

"Yes, Dr. Clover," Adrian said succinctly. "I woke you up to explain a few things."

The others silently looked at Adrian.

"First, Dr. Clover, I have unfortunate news," Adrian said solemnly. "Ohara has been completely destroyed by the Buster Call." {You don't have any shame, do you?}

Dr. Clover let out a long sigh. "I understand."

Adrian explained, "For the World Government, destroying Ohara was their primary goal. If they failed, they would scour the seas to hunt down every Ohara 'survivor.'"

"I'm aware of that." Dr. Clover nodded. "You've worked hard, Adrian."

"Secondly, I plan to relocate Ohara's survivors to the North Blue through my own channels."

"The North Blue…" Dr. Clover pondered for a moment, quickly understanding Adrian's intentions.

"By the way, Dr. Clover, I have another question." Adrian asked, "Regardless, the scholars should not continue living with the civilians. Have you considered an alternative?"

"An alternative?" Dr. Clover gave a bitter smile. "Researching forbidden history leaves no room for alternatives!"

Adrian asked, "Then where can Ohara's scholars go?"

After a long silence, Dr. Clover said, "Perhaps the little sky island is the last suitable place for scholars."

"Sigh, it's we scholars who want to uncover history, yet the innocent civilians suffer," Dr. Clover said despondently. "I have no face to confront them now…"

Adrian didn't intend to comfort Dr. Clover's despondent words.

As Dr. Clover himself admitted, Ohara's suffering was ultimately the fault of the scholars.

Even though their goal was to reveal the lost history to the world, they should have been more protective and secretive.

Adrian then turned to the Nico mother and daughter.

"Now, it's your turn, Mrs. Nico and little Robin." Adrian spoke slowly, "Ohara is now history. What do you two plan to do?"

Robin looked conflictedly at Adrian, then at her mother.

Nico Olvia firmly stated, "I greatly appreciate your help with Ohara, but I won't give up pursuing history!"

"Mom!" Robin exclaimed anxiously.

Nico Olvia looked down at Robin with an apologetic and pained expression, "I'm sorry, Robin."

Mrs. Penelope, standing nearby, looked at Robin with a pained expression. During their time together, she had come to see this clever girl as her own.

But as Robin's biological mother, Nico Olvia's own wishes took precedence, and Mrs. Penelope refrained from intervening.

Adrian shook his head slightly, not intending to meddle in their family affairs.

He then turned to Mrs. Penelope and asked gently, "Madam, what are your plans?"

"Me?" Mrs. Penelope shifted her gaze from Robin, speaking calmly, "Perona is still young. I just want a period of peace."

Adrian concluded decisively, "Then let's go to the sky island above!"
